Product descriptionThe HowlingA graduate of Roger Corman s school of low-budget ingenuity Joe Dante gained enough momentum with 1978 sPiranha to rise to the challenge ofThe Howling and he brought alongPiranha screenwriter John Sayles to cowrite this instant werewolf classic. Makeup wizard Rob Bottin was recruited to create what was then the wildest onscreen transformation ever seen. With Gary Brandner s novelThe Howling as a starting point Sayles and Dante conceived a werewolf colony on the California coast posing as a self-help haven LED by a seemingly benevolent doctor (Patrick Macnee) and populated by a variety of patients from sexy leather-clad sirens (among them Elisabeth Brooks) to an old coot (John Carradine) who s quite literally long in the tooth. When a TV reporter (Dee Wallace) arrives at the colony to recover from a recent trauma the resident lycanthropes prepare for a howlin good time.
